How to Cancel Your Uber One Membership: A Step-by-Step Guide
Canceling Uber One is straightforward, but a little guidance ensures you won’t miss any critical steps or face unexpected surprises.
Step 1: Open the Uber App
Your journey starts on the Uber app. Make sure you’re logged in with the account associated with your Uber One membership.
Step 2: Access the Account Menu
Tap on the Menu icon, usually represented by three horizontal lines or a profile picture at the top-left corner of the app screen.
Step 3: Navigate to the Uber One Section
In the menu, select "Uber One" to enter the membership-specific settings. This section displays your membership benefits, renewal date, and more.
Step 4: Initiate Cancellation
Scroll to the bottom of the Uber One page and tap on "Cancel Membership." Uber will prompt you to confirm your decision, often offering details of remaining benefits to encourage reconsideration.
Step 5: Confirm Cancelation
Follow the on-screen prompts to confirm your cancellation. You might be asked to provide a reason for canceling—feel free to skip or select a reason that best aligns with your situation.
Step 6: Monitor for Confirmation
You should receive confirmation of your cancellation, typically via email and an app notification. Keep an eye out for this confirmation to ensure the process was successful.

What Happens After Cancelation?
Now that you’ve canceled your Uber One membership, here’s what you can expect in terms of service and benefits.
Use Remaining Benefits
After cancelation, you often retain access to benefits until the end of the billing cycle. It's a good opportunity to maximize any discounts or perks still available.
Understanding Refunds
Typically, Uber One memberships are non-refundable unless stated otherwise in specific promotions or trials. Be sure to review membership terms for any exceptions.
Re-enrollment Options
If down the line you miss Uber One perks, re-enrolling is hassle-free. Keep in mind any changes to membership rates or benefits if you consider rejoining.
